Important:
Please be careful when inserting, removing, or
handling the microSD card and its adapter
because is it easily damaged during improper
operation.
Do not over-insert the card as this can damage
the contact pins.
Be sure to use only recommended memory
cards. Using non-recommend memory cards
could cause data loss and damage to your
phone.
Make sure the battery is fully charged before
using the memory card. Your data may become
damaged or unusable if the battery runs out while
using the memory card.

Important:
The formatting procedure erases all the data on
the microSD card, after which you CANNOT
retrieve files. To prevent the loss of important data,
please check the contents before you format the
card.

Unmount the microSD Card

When you need to remove the microSD card, you must
first unmount the microSD card to prevent corrupting
the data stored on it or damaging the card. Since you
will remove the battery first before you can remove the
microSD card, close all running applications on your
phone and save any data first.
